Key Insights at a Glance

Procedure Time

Typically takes around 2-3 hours to complete

Recovery Period

Most people can return to normal activities within 1-2 weeks

Expected Results

Significant and sustained weight loss, improved blood sugar control, and reduced risk of obesity-related health problems

Ideal Candidates

Individuals struggling with significant weight, often with a BMI of 40 or higher, who have tried other weight loss methods without success

Things to Check Before Treatment

  • Discuss your medical history with the surgeon, including any previous surgeries or health conditions.
  • Get a thorough physical examination to identify any potential issues.
  • Ensure you have all necessary test results and lab reports before undergoing the procedure.
  • Review and understand the surgical plan, including the scope of the surgery and what to expect during recovery.
  • Make sure your surgeon is certified to perform sleeve gastrectomy procedures.
Risk warning

Potential Risks

  • Bleeding or hematoma (a collection of blood under the skin)
  • Infection
  • Scarring and keloid formation
  • Gastrointestinal complications, such as nausea, vomiting, or diarrhea
  • Nutrient deficiencies due to malabsorption
